Do actors kiss in kissing scenes?

Yes, actors do kiss in kissing scenes. However, there are certain guidelines and protocols that are followed by the actors, directors, and producers to ensure that the scene is filmed in a professional and comfortable manner for all parties involved.

Firstly, the actors are given a script in advance that allows them to prepare for the scene. They are also briefed by the director and producers about the expectations and limitations of the scene. Actors are often given the option to use a body double or a stunt double if they are uncomfortable with certain aspects of the scene, such as nudity or physical intimacy.

During filming, the kissing scene is carefully choreographed, rehearsed, and blocked to ensure that it is executed smoothly and effectively. The actors are often provided with breath mints or mouthwash to maintain fresh breath, and makeup artists are on hand to touch up the actors’ appearances if needed.

To further ensure that both actors are comfortable during the kissing scenes, they may agree on the duration and intensity of the kiss in advance. This helps to avoid any misunderstanding or miscommunication on set.

In some cases, a kiss might be filmed using different camera angles, close-ups, or editing techniques to create the illusion of a longer, more passionate kiss. Movie magic and special effects may also be utilized to enhance the scene.

Overall, actors do kiss in kissing scenes, but it is a carefully planned and executed process that aims to create a compelling and believable scene for the audience, while maintaining the professionalism and comfort of those involved.

Where do actors sleep on set?

Actors usually have their own trailers, which serve as a personal space for them to relax, rest, and prepare for their scenes. These trailers are also commonly called dressing rooms, and they are typically equipped with all the amenities that an actor would need to spend long hours on a film or TV set.

The trailers can vary in size and level of luxury, depending on the production budget and the status of the actor.

The dressing rooms are usually located near the set or on location, and they may be separated by gender or assigned according to the actors’ hierarchy in the cast. The trailers may have basic features such as a bed, a restroom, a shower, a closet, a mirror, and a makeup area. In some cases, the trailers may also have a living area with a TV, a couch, and some kitchen appliances.

Additionally, some actors may choose to bring their own portable beds or air mattresses to the set in case they need to take a nap or rest between scenes. Depending on the length of the shoot, actors may spend several hours, or even days, in their trailers, especially during the filming of extensive sequences or demanding scenes.

Some actors might prefer to sleep in their personal trailers during breaks in the shoot to avoid distractions, while others may socialize on set or find alternative places to rest, such as couches or empty rooms. the sleeping arrangements for an actor depend on their personal preferences and the guidelines set by the production team.

Nevertheless, actors must be well-rested, alert, and ready to perform at their best, and having a comfortable and private space, such as a trailer, can help them achieve that.

How do you build chemistry between actors?

There are a few key things that can help build chemistry between actors on screen. Firstly, having a clear understanding of the characters and their relationships with each other is essential. This means spending time developing detailed backstories and understanding the motivations behind each character’s actions.

Another important factor is rehearsal time. The more time actors spend working together, the better they will understand each other’s styles and work together to create a cohesive performance. This can involve running scenes multiple times, experimenting with pacing and tone, and discussing the characters’ emotional states and motivations.

In addition to rehearsal, it’s also important to create an environment where actors feel comfortable and supported. This can involve building trust and getting to know each other outside of work, whether that’s through social events or simply spending time chatting on set.

Finally, having a strong director who can guide the actors and help them find common ground is key. A good director will be able to provide feedback and direction without undermining the actors’ creative input, and will work closely with them to ensure they are all on the same page with regards to character development and performance.

Building chemistry between actors takes time, effort and collaboration. By working together and supporting each other’s creative efforts, actors can create performances that truly resonate with audiences and leave a lasting impact.
